🧩 What Makes a USB-C Cable Ideal for Portable Monitors?
Not all USB-C cables are created equal. Here’s what to look for:
✅ Full USB 3.2 Gen 2 or Thunderbolt 3/4 support
✅ DisplayPort Alt Mode for seamless video
✅ 100W Power Delivery (PD) or higher
✅ Durable build: braided or reinforced connectors
✅ Ideal cable length: 3ft–6ft for most setups

🛠️ Pro Tips Before You Buy
Shorter = More Reliable: Stick to 3ft if you can. Longer cables are more prone to signal degradation.
Check your monitor’s specs: Not every USB-C monitor supports video over all cables.
Look for E-Marker chips if you’re going over 60W.
